    About Washington International Horse Show

    In recent years, the Washington International Horse Show has continued to thrive, adapting to the changes in the sport and audience engagement. Currently hosted annually at the Capital One Arena in Washington, D.C., the show features not only thrilling competitions but also educational programs and family-friendly activities. For instance, the WIHS offers various community outreach programs, such as the 'WIHS Barn Night' where local equestrian enthusiasts can engage with professionals and learn more about the sport. Additionally, the show has embraced digital platforms, allowing fans from around the world to tune in and experience the excitement of the events via live streaming. The latest editions of the WIHS have attracted top riders from around the globe, including Olympians, enhancing the competitive landscape and drawing larger crowds. Moreover, the event hosts special exhibitions, such as the 'Sheila B. Johnson Style & Art Show,' that highlight the intersection of equestrian culture with the arts. As it heads into its next iteration, the Washington International Horse Show continues to be a pivotal event for the equestrian community, blending tradition with innovation to engage and entertain audiences.

    Washington International Horse Show History

    The Washington International Horse Show (WIHS) is a prestigious equestrian event established in 1922, making it one of the oldest horse shows in the United States. Originally held at the D.C. Armory, the event quickly gained a reputation for attracting top-tier competitors and showcasing a range of riding disciplines, including show jumping, dressage, and hunter classes. Over the years, it has moved locations, but its legacy of excellence has persisted. The show is notable not only for its competitive events but also for its efforts to promote the sport of equestrianism among a broader audience. The WIHS has drawn celebrities and dignitaries alike, adding to the allure and prestige of the event. Additionally, the show has also embraced various charitable initiatives, contributing to local and national causes. As the event evolved, it became a key fixture in the equestrian calendar, influencing the development of similar competitions across the nation and establishing standards for precision and skill.
